Script Sulab 8 is a very light, narrow, high contrast, italic, very short x-height font.

A delicate formal script with thin hairline strokes and pronounced thick–thin modulation that evokes pointed-pen calligraphy. Letterforms are strongly slanted with long, tapering entry and exit strokes, and many capitals feature extended swashes that arc above or ahead of the main stem. The lowercase maintains a tight rhythm with compact bowls and a relatively low x-height, while ascenders and descenders are elongated, giving lines a tall, vertical shimmer. Counters stay open despite the fine strokes, and spacing is slightly variable in a handwritten way, especially around swash capitals and narrow connectors.

Best suited to short to medium lines where its fine strokes and swash capitals can be appreciated—wedding stationery, event invitations, beauty and boutique branding, packaging accents, and elegant headline treatments. It can also work for signatures or monogram-style marks when generous spacing and size help preserve its hairline details.

The overall tone is poised and intimate—more like formal handwriting than display brush lettering. It reads as romantic and ceremonial, with a light, airy presence that feels luxurious rather than bold or casual.

The design appears intended to mimic refined, pen-written script with dramatic contrast and ornamental capitals, prioritizing sophistication and flourish over utilitarian text setting. Its proportions and extended terminals suggest it was drawn to create a graceful, upscale impression in display contexts.

Uppercase letters are the main visual event, with prominent leading strokes and looping terminals that can increase the effective width of initial letters in words. Numerals are similarly slender and slightly cursive in posture, matching the calligraphic contrast and maintaining a cohesive texture alongside the alphabet.
